PRad-II Event Viewer — Server API Reference
Base URL: http://localhost:<port> (default port 5051).
All responses are JSON unless noted otherwise. The server also pushes real-time updates over a WebSocket connection on the same port.

Start the server with -i (or --interactive) to enable the stdin command interface:
prad2_server data.evio -H -i
Command
Description
status
Show current mode, file info, ET connection
load <path> [1]
Load an evio file (append 1 for histograms)
online
Switch to ET/online mode
offline
Switch to file/offline mode
clear hist|lms|epics
Clear accumulators
filter
Show current filter state
filter load <f>
Load event filter from JSON file
filter unload
Remove all filters
quit / exit
Stop the server
help
Show command list
Filters control which events are navigable and accumulated in file mode.
Load from a file (-f filter.json) or at runtime via the API / UI panel.
Method
Endpoint
Description
GET
/api/filter
Current filter state
POST
/api/filter/load
Load filter (JSON body). Rebuilds indices and histograms
POST
/api/filter/unload
Remove all filters. Rebuilds
GET
/api/filter/indices
List of 1-based event indices passing the filter
{
"waveform" : {
"enable" : true ,
"modules" : [" W100" , " W101" ],
"n_peaks_min" : 1 , "n_peaks_max" : 999999 ,
"time_min" : 160 , "time_max" : 220 ,
"integral_min" : 100 , "integral_max" : 15000 ,
"height_min" : 20 , "height_max" : 4000
},
"clustering" : {
"enable" : true ,
"n_min" : 1 , "n_max" : 999999 ,
"energy_min" : 50 , "energy_max" : 2500 ,
"size_min" : 1 , "size_max" : 999999 ,
"includes_modules" : [" W100" , " G25" ], "includes_min" : 1 ,
"center_modules" : [" W100" , " W101" ]
}
}
Each section has enable: false by default. All other fields optional.
Events pass if ALL enabled filters return true. Loading/unloading clears
accumulated data and rebuilds histograms if the file was preprocessed.
